Albert Edelfelt: a pioneer of Finnish realism
Albert Edelfelt, an iconic figure of 19th-century Finnish art, captured the essence of his country through his works. Trained in Paris, he was influenced by the Impressionist masters but also incorporated elements of realism. His career, marked by travels across Europe, allowed him to explore various styles while remaining deeply attached to his Nordic roots. Edelfelt played a crucial role in establishing Finnish artistic identity, and his works, like this art print, testify to his commitment to representing the beauty of his homeland.
